SYRACUSE, NY – The NUAIR Alliance has hired Major General Marke F. “Hoot” Gibson (ret) as its new Chief Executive Officer (CEO). Gibson most recently served as Senior Advisor on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S) Integration to the Deputy Administrator of the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A). He begins November 13 and will oversee the organization’s efforts to safety integrate UAS into the National Airspace System (NAS).

Gibson will lead NUAIR’s oversight of UAS testing being conducted in New York, Massachusetts and Michigan and a $30 million investment by New York State to build a 50-mile UTM Corridor and put the region at the forefront of UAS research and development.

In November of 2016, Governor Andrew M. Cuomo announced a $30 million investment to develop the 50-mile flight traffic management system between Syracuse and Griffiss International Airport in Rome to advance the burgeoning Unmanned Aircraft Systems industry in Central New York as part of the CNY Rising initiative. Within the 50-mile corridor, strategic investments will accelerate industry growth by supporting emerging uses of Unmanned Aircraft Systems in key industries, including agriculture and forest management, transportation and logistics, media and film development, utilities and infrastructure, and public safety.

Gibson previously served as executive director of the NextGen Institute, which provides professional services to the UAS Joint Program Development Office. He has also owned his own aviation consulting firm.

Gibson retired from the U.S. Air Force in 2011 after 33 years of service and holding numerous senior command and staff positions earning him the rank of Major General. He retired as the Air Force’s director of current operations and training where he led the startup of a new cyber career field and its integration into Air Force operations. Gibson also worked on behalf of the Air Force secretary and chief of staff on ways to better integrate un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) into the national airspace. This involved continuous engagement with the FAA, Homeland Defense and numerous congressional delegations. As the director of training, Gibson was also responsible for the startup of a separate career field and unique training path for those who fly Air Force remote piloted aircrafts today.

ABOUT NUAIR

The Northeast UAS Airspace Integration Research Alliance (NUAIR Alliance) is a consortium of industry leaders and academic institutions throughout New York and Massachusetts, led by the CenterState Corporation for Economic Opportunity (CEO), in New York, and MassDevelopment, in Massachusetts. CenterState CEO is an organization of 2,000 companies that work together to increase business competitiveness, community prosperity, and regional growth in the 12-county CenterState New York region. MassDevelopment, the Commonwealth’s finance and development agency, works with businesses, nonprofits, financial institutions, and communities to stimulate economic growth throughout Massachusetts. Under the leadership of MassDevelopment and CenterState CEO, industry experts and academic institutions in both states formed NUAIR and combined assets, expertise and experience to compete for a FAA-designated UAS testing site. Organizations partnering with Griffiss International Airport and NUAIR include Saab Sensis, SRC, Raytheon and Lockheed Martin, together with colleges and universities including Rochester Institute of Technology, Massachusetts Institute of Technology, University of Massachusetts institutions, Syracuse University, Clarkson University and Northeastern University, among others.
